Precision Cleaning: A Contemporary Method for Area Revival
Laser cleaning represents a contemporary solution to surface revival, offering a accurate and gentle alternative to traditional techniques. This process utilizes a intense beam of radiation to efficiently ablate debris and revive the original appearance of a range of materials. The system provides excellent results on delicate artifacts and intricate fabrications, ensuring minimal damage while achieving a full clear result. Unlike abrasive processes, laser cleaning avoids introducing further scratches or modifying the base composition.

Applications of Laser Cleaning: From Aerospace to Art
Laser ablation purification process has found a broad range of implementations, reaching far beyond initial forecasts. In aeronautics, it carefully eliminates contaminants from critical sections—like turbine blades and radiative shields—ensuring optimal operation. Meanwhile, restorers utilize laser remediation to cautiously uncover the original beauty of historic frescoes , while harming the fragile sub-surface composition . This adaptable procedure is also progressively employed in vehicular production , archaeology , and even electronics assembly.
